Membership

Any full time peace officer from a municipal police department, Iowa Department of Public Safety or the Iowa DOT Law Enforcement Division is eligible for membership in the ISPA.  An annual fee of $50 for active members and $35 for retired members, is all that is needed to become a part of Iowa's largest association of law enforcement professionals.

Any municipal police department, subunit of the Department of Public Safety or the Iowa DOT Law Enforcement Division may form a local association and apply for recognition as such to the ISPA. Local associations with three or more members may send delegates to the Iowa State Police Association's Annual Conference.

All members that retire in good standing may continue their membership in the ISPA for as long as they wish. Retired members continue to enjoy the same benefits as active members.
